Output 97d536e1981d0c677340c158b20b2b06b28c702deffeb5ae06690ee7a5eb3b6e:2

value
1032989
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a30ece3db5cd4884b5b5e01ecac2b17a4b3e5c3 OP_EQUAL
address
3EHhnQhSrtYJzLJyQPfYjwgY4gv9w96Abk
transaction
97d536e1981d0c677340c158b20b2b06b28c702deffeb5ae06690ee7a5eb3b6e
spent
true